Understanding the Importance of Monitoring in Large-Scale Deployments
Before diving into the practical applications, it’s essential to understand why monitoring is so critical in large-scale deployments. Imagine a scenario where a company operates a global e-commerce platform, handling millions of transactions daily. Without effective monitoring, it would be challenging to identify and address issues promptly, leading to potential outages, poor user experience, and financial losses.
# Key Benefits of Monitoring
1. Real-Time Insights: Monitoring tools provide real-time visibility into system performance, allowing teams to detect and rectify issues before they become critical.
2. Proactive Maintenance: By continuously monitoring the health of systems, teams can predict and prevent potential failures, ensuring high availability.
3. Cost Efficiency: Effective monitoring helps in identifying and eliminating inefficiencies, leading to cost savings in terms of resources and maintenance.

# Section 2: Scalability and Load Balancing
Scalability is crucial for large-scale deployments, ensuring that systems can handle increasing loads without performance degradation. Monitoring plays a vital role in this process by providing insights into resource utilization and system behavior.
Case Study: Airbnb’s Dynamic Load Balancing
Airbnb uses a dynamic load balancing system to distribute traffic across its servers efficiently. By monitoring key performance indicators (KPIs) such as CPU usage, memory consumption, and network latency, Airbnb can dynamically adjust the load distribution, ensuring optimal performance during peak usage times.
Key Takeaways:
- Resource Utilization Monitoring: Regularly monitoring resource usage helps in identifying bottlenecks and optimizing resource allocation.
- Dynamic Load Balancing: Implementing dynamic load balancing can significantly enhance system performance and availability.
# Section 3: Security and Compliance
In today’s digital landscape, security and compliance are paramount. Monitoring tools not only help in identifying security breaches but also in ensuring adherence to regulatory requirements.
Case Study: Mastercard’s Security Monitoring System
Mastercard employs a comprehensive security monitoring system to detect and respond to potential security threats. By leveraging advanced analytics and machine learning algorithms, the system identifies unusual activities and potential breaches in real-time, ensuring the security of its vast network.
Key Takeaways:
- Security Breaches Detection: Implementing real-time security monitoring can help in identifying and mitigating security threats promptly.
- Compliance Monitoring: Monitoring tools can also ensure compliance with regulatory requirements by tracking and analyzing data usage.
